Treatment Population
A group of individuals receiving the treatment or intervention in a study to assess its effectiveness.
Control Population
A group in an experimental study that does not receive the treatment and is used as a benchmark to measure how the other tested groups compare.
Significance Level
The threshold below which an observed result is considered statistically significant, usually denoted by alpha.
Sample Data
Data collected from a portion of a larger population, used to make inferences about the whole population.
